Best Schools for International/Global Studies in Colorado

Below are the schools that deliver the strongest overall international/global studies education in Colorado.

Top Schools in International/Global Studies

1

University Of Denver is one of the finest schools in the country for getting a degree in international/global studies. Set in the city of Denver, University Of Denver is a large private not-for-profit institution. Roughly 76% of students complete a degree within six years here. There were roughly 20 international/global studies students who graduated with this degree at University Of Denver in the most recent data year. International/global Studies graduates of University Of Denver earn a median of $56,999 early in their careers. Students borrow a median of $22,534 to complete this degree. 2

University Of Colorado Boulder is one of the finest schools in the country for a degree in international/global studies, ranking #2. This very large public university is located in the city of Boulder. About 74% of students finish within six years. There were roughly 99 international/global studies students who graduated with this degree at University Of Colorado Boulder in the most recent data year. Soon after graduation, international/global studies degree recipients from University Of Colorado Boulder generally make around $33,892. Typical student debt for the program is $17,600. 3

Colorado State University Fort Collins is a great choice for students pursuing a degree in international/global studies, landing the #3 spot this year. Located in the city of Fort Collins, Colorado State University Fort Collins is a very large public university. Colorado State University Fort Collins graduates 66% of students within six years. There were roughly 28 international/global studies students who graduated with this degree at Colorado State University Fort Collins in the most recent data year. Students who receive their international/global studies degree from Colorado State University Fort Collins earn around $28,919 in the first couple years of their career. 4

A rank of #4 makes University Of Northern Colorado one of the top schools for international/global studies. This large public university is located in the city of Greeley. About 51% of students finish within six years. About 10 international/global studies degrees were awarded at University Of Northern Colorado in the most recent year. International/global Studies graduates of University Of Northern Colorado earn a median of $45,705 early in their careers. Typical student debt for the program is $23,974. 5

University Of Colorado Denver is a great choice for students pursuing a degree in international/global studies, landing the #5 spot this year. Located in the city of Denver, University Of Colorado Denver is a very large public university. About 46% of students finish within six years. University Of Colorado Denver awarded about 14 international/global studies degrees in the most recent data year. Soon after graduation, international/global studies degree recipients from University Of Colorado Denver generally make around $25,307. Notes and References

This ranking is produced by College Factual (MF_RANKING_2025), 2026 edition. Schools are scored on a blend of student outcomes (graduation rate, post-graduation earnings), affordability, and program focus, drawn primarily from the U.S. Department of Education (IPEDS and College Scorecard).

Ranking method: College Major Top Ranked · 7 schools evaluated.
